"Chris,


thank you for the inquiry. the injectors have the same shape and size as the 1990 Series 5 injectors and therefore are a direct fit in every way for either the primary or secondary injectors.
Yes, the pintle caps have a 4-hole version while the OEM ones utilize a pintle sprayer. You will have no problem with compatibility, reliability or spray pattern with these. thank you!

It will physically fit, but the pintle is was too short to fit inside the injector bleed once the lower o-ring is installed. The result will probably be a vacuum leak.
